Starting stage 3 tomorrow and need recipe help



Recommended Posts

I am so confused thinking about the next stage. I get things have to be soft but my team says Protein first then vegetables. How is everyone making recipes and doing the protein first? I am really interested in everyone's go to or favorite stage 3 foods. Thanks so much!

I didn't make many recipes until I was cleared for regular food. For the soft stage I think I started eating yogurt with small bits of fruit, soft scrambled eggs, chili, meatballs with Low Sugar sauce, string cheese, and turkey lunch meat. i ate no veggies because there wasn't any room once I ate the Protein.

Same here - no recipes. I’m about to finish my fifth week and just now trying chicken and composed meals. And they go down but with a little bit of a fuss. I ate/eat:

Yogurt, apple sauce, Soups, refried Beans, avocado, soft bananas, smoothies (careful with berry seeds), ground turkey (not beef or chicken) cooked in broth/liquids or sugar free Pasta Sauce, turkey lunch meat, mashed cauliflower, soft pears, soft beans, turkey and white bean chili from whole foods, egg whites (tummy didn’t like eggs until this week), tuna salad without celery or onions, egg salad - as simple as possible. I didn’t have sensitivity to a normal amount of spices but I tried some chicken & turmeric Soup and my whole body rejected it.
